HGC, IGC and AMS-IX go live with a new Internet Exchange in Bangkok

Leading Internet Exchange AMS-IX, together with HGC Global Communications Limited (HGC), a fully-fledged ICT service provider and network operator with extensive global coverage, and International Gateway Company Limited (IGC), a neutral regional telecommunication and network service provider, are happy to announce that AMS-IX Bangkok is live and ready for operations.

The new Internet Exchange will support the growth of the Internet through effective traffic localisation, acceleration of enterprise digitisation, and community support. Networks connected to AMS-IX Bangkok will benefit from lower operation costs, enhanced connectivity, better redundancy and lower latency.

Bangkok is strategically located at the heart of Southeast Asia which makes it ideal as an international hub for exchanging Internet traffic and a perfect location as a gateway to the Greater Mekong Subregion (GMS). It is one of the prime locations where Internet companies exchange Internet traffic besides Singapore and Hong Kong. Nearly 250 million eyeballs in Southeast Asia can now enjoy an uplifted online experience.

Under the terms of the partnership, HGC will serve as a commercial partner and marketing arm for AMS-IX Bangkok, while IGC provides IX infrastructure, network, and operation in Bangkok. AMS-IX, with their expertise on peering and network monitoring, will give technical support and has operational management of the exchange.

Onno Bos, International Partnership Director of AMS-IX, says: “It is great to announce yet another successful deployment of an AMS-IX Internet Exchange in Asia with our partner HGC. This new IX will have a significant effect on the Internet ecosystem as it will make it easier and more cost effective to let international CDNs connect to local eyeballs.”

Chirawat Mahawat, Vice President Greater Mekong Subregion of HGC says: “We are proud for the live of AMS-IX Bangkok as the enhancement of the HGC EdgeX brand for OTT ecosystem. We believe the exchange, with initial members on board, will boost content exchanging especially those who looks for the eyeballs coverage”

Pichit Satapattayanont, Chief Executive Officer of IGC says: “The AMS-IX exchange will definitely encourage growth of the digital economy ecosystem. With our neutral positioning, we are welcome to support both content and telco players to be part of this growth”
